A character named Danyeop has died, seemingly as a self-inflicted sacrifice, yet the blame is being placed squarely on Mu-Won. This event has galvanized a faction known as the \"Silent Night,\" a group described as former \"fake villains\" who had lost all hope after being manipulated by a greater power. Viewing Danyeop as a martyr, they have been spurred into a final, desperate charge against the world. This turmoil introduces a new, physically unsettling antagonist from the Central Heavenly Alliance, noted by observers for his bizarre and grotesque appearance. Despite his personal quest being focused on saving his loved ones, Mu-Won finds himself a scapegoat in a larger conspiracy, burdened by the fallout of a suicidal act he had no part in, and facing the ire of a hopeless faction now violently reawakened.","summary_source":"graph_aggregator","summary_status":"generated","summary_verification":"unverified"},"summary":"Following the emotional reunion with his injured father figure, Hwang-Cheol, Jin Mu-Won is immediately thrust into a new and complex conflict rooted in misunderstanding and tragedy.
